1.School of Biological Sciences and Engineering, Shaanxi University of Technology, Hanzhong 723001;2.Hanzhong Agricultural Technology Promotion and Training Center, Hanzhong 723000, Shaanxi
Foundation projects: Shaanxi Provincial Department of Science and Technology Project(2023-YBNY-267);The Ministry of Biological Resources and Ecology and Environment of Qinba Jointly Established the State Key Laboratory (Cultivation) of the "City-School Co-construction" Scientific Research Project(SXC-2303)